dc.description.abstractThe purpose of this paper is to detail one method to re-implement Sederberg and Parry’s free-form deformation algorithm using modern programming tools. Design details and detailed implementation steps for creating a free-form deformation application are presented in this report. The advantages, disadvantages, and uses of the free-form deformation algorithm are explored to allow readers to think of further extensions and improvements that can be made to the implementation to create better tools for 3D modelling.en_US
